Revolutionizing Healthcare Data Discovery: New Frontiers for Medical Information Retrieval

As the volume of medical data explodes exponentially, traditional search engines like MedSearch are increasingly struggling to keep pace. Clinicians require access to accurate, timely, and relevant information to provide optimal patient care, but sifting through vast here amounts of unstructured text can be a daunting endeavor. The future of medical information retrieval lies in exploring innovative alternatives that go beyond keyword-based searches.

Cutting-edge technologies such as artificial intelligence (AI), machine learning (ML), and natural language processing (NLP) hold immense potential for transforming how we query medical knowledge.

  • Machine learning-driven search engines can analyze complex relationships within medical data, providing more accurate results that align with specific clinical needs.
  • Medical ontologies can represent medical concepts and their interconnectedness, enabling users to navigate the vast landscape of medical knowledge in a more intuitive and meaningful way.
  • Intelligent agents can assist clinicians by providing quick answers to clinical queries, summarizing patient records, and even suggesting potential diagnoses or treatment options.
